Western blot - Anti-Integrin alpha V antibody [EPR16800] - BSA and Azide free (AB271932)
This data was developed using ab179475, the same antibody clone in a different buffer formulation.
Western blot : Anti-Integrin alpha V antibody [EPR16800] ab179475 staining at 1/5000 dilution, shown in green; Mouse anti alpha Tubulin ab7291 loading control staining at 1/20000 dilution, shown in magenta. A band was observed at 116 kDa in Wild-type HCT 116 cell lysates with no signal observed at this size in ITGAV knockout HCT 116 cell line. To generate this image, samples were run on an SDS-PAGE gel then transferred onto a nitrocellulose membrane. Membranes were blocked in 100pc LICOR in TBS-0.1 % Tween 20 (TBS-T) before incubation with primary antibodies overnight at 4 C. Blots were washed four times in TBS-T, incubated with secondary antibodies for 1 h at room temperature, washed again four times then imaged. Secondary antibodies used were Goat anti-Rabbit 800CW and Goat anti-Mouse 680RD at 1/20,000 dilution.

Biological function summary
Integrin alpha V plays a pivotal role in cellular processes such as migration proliferation and survival. It participates in the formation of multi-molecular complexes within cellular structures. The integrin av integrins particularly in conjunction with its CD51/CD61 form contribute to the regulation of angiogenesis immune response and wound healing. These functions arise from the integrin’s ability to act as a receptor for numerous ligands including fibrinogen fibronectin and vitronectin.
Pathways
Integrin alpha V is a critical component of the integrin signaling and focal adhesion pathways. These pathways involve a network of interactions that include proteins like focal adhesion kinase (FAK) and Src family kinases. Integrin alpha V’s interaction within these pathways assists in transmitting mechanical signals from the extracellular environment to the intracellular signaling cascades affecting cytoskeleton dynamics and gene expression. The pathway interactions with integrin av also coordinate complex signaling with other receptors and matrix proteins like laminins enhancing cellular communication and response to environmental changes.
